What is NLP?
NLP stands for “Natural Language Processing,” a branch of artificial intelligence that enables computers to understand, interpret, and respond to human language. NLP focuses on deciphering and processing the meaning of natural language that people use to communicate through speech, writing, and text. This technology makes a range of applications and services possible, including text mining, machine translation, sentiment analysis, automatic text summarization, and language understanding.
Components of NLP Technology
Text Data Processing: This involves collecting, cleaning, and processing text data. This step includes understanding the structure of language and organizing text data.
Natural Language Understanding: The ability to understand text data encompasses grasping grammatical features and meaning in the text. This includes understanding how words, sentences, and expressions relate to each other.
Information Extraction: NLP systems can extract information from text data. For example, identifying names, dates, or key topics from an article.
Sentiment Analysis: Sentiment analysis involves recognizing the emotional tones expressed in texts. This can be used to understand positive or negative emotional content in customer feedback or social media posts.
Machine Translation: NLP is used to translate text written in one language into another. For instance, automatically translating an English text into Spanish.
Language Generation: This allows computers to generate human-like texts. It’s used for text-based chatbots and automatic article writing.
NLP technology has a wide range of applications, including automation, customer service, sentiment analysis, text mining, machine translation, text generation, and many other areas. This technology plays a crucial role in big data analytics and language processing, helping to achieve more efficient and meaningful results by better understanding text data.

Data Analysis and Monitoring with NLP Reports
Field sales teams often work in different regions, making it difficult for businesses to collect and analyze field sales data. NLP can help sales teams analyze text-based data and extract meaningful insights. Here are some examples of how NLP reports can be used:
- Customer Feedback Analysis: Field sales representatives take notes during customer visits, and these notes can be analyzed with NLP to gain valuable insights into customer satisfaction and needs.
- Competitor Analysis: Field sales teams can gather information about competitor products and pricing, and NLP can analyze this data to identify competitive advantages or threats.
- Identifying Sales Opportunities: Text analysis can be used to identify potential sales opportunities, reducing the risk of missing potential sales by examining customer communications.
Real-Time Alerts and Quick Response
Time is of the essence for field sales teams. Real-time alerts and notifications enable team members to respond quickly to important events. Here are some examples of how real-time alerts and notifications can be used:
- Stock Level Alerts: An NLP-enabled system can detect when the stock level of a particular product reaches a critical level and instantly send alerts to team members.
- Customer Visit Reminders: The system can remind a team member that they need to visit a customer and provide the necessary information to speed up the preparation process.
- Customer Requests: Instant notifications about important requests or issues from customers can help quickly resolve problems.

The NLP feature measures sentiment in the notes of sales teams within the organization, generating a score indicating whether the sentiment is positive, negative, or neutral. Using this infrastructure, notes with negative sentiment scores below a certain threshold are instantly shared with the management team via the Ekmob application.
Managers, especially in large or highly active teams, can sometimes overlook important activities or notes amidst the usual daily busyness. This can result in missed opportunities for taking action, providing feedback to the team, obtaining additional information, or informing different departments. Therefore, the system measures sentiment using Google infrastructure and sends notifications to managers about important points. This ensures that issues requiring attention, based on customer interactions and notes received, are promptly identified and addressed.

NLP Application Areas?
Text Mining and Information Extraction: NLP analyzes large text datasets to extract meaningful information from them. It is used particularly for automatically analyzing text data such as news articles, social media texts, and web pages to extract important insights.
Machine Translation: NLP forms the basis of translation systems that can automatically translate one language to another. Platforms like Google Translate utilize this technology.
Sentiment Analysis: NLP is used in sentiment analysis applications to understand emotional expressions in texts. This is useful for customer feedback, product reviews, and social media analysis.
Speech Recognition and Speech-to-Text: NLP powers speech recognition and speech-to-text systems that convert speech data into text. Voice assistants like Siri, Alexa, and Google Assistant utilize this technology.
Chatbots and Virtual Assistants: NLP is a fundamental component for chatbots and virtual assistants with capabilities for automatic response and answering questions. They are used in customer service, information provision, booking appointments, and more.
Text-Based Education: In the education sector, NLP is used to monitor student performance, provide feedback to students, and assess their learning needs using text data.
Healthcare Services: In healthcare, NLP is used to analyze hospital records, medical reports, and patient data. It aids in processing patient data and extracting information.
Security and Intelligence: Intelligence agencies use NLP to monitor and understand the activities of terrorist or criminal organizations. Big data analytics and text mining are particularly crucial in these domains.
E-commerce and Marketing: E-commerce platforms and marketing companies use NLP for analyzing customer reviews, providing product recommendations, social media monitoring, and customer service.
Finance and Banking: Financial institutions use NLP for addressing customer complaints, conducting market analysis, fraud detection, and developing trading strategies.
NLP enhances big data analytics and automation across various industries by enabling meaningful processing of text and language, thus expanding its application areas continuously.
